Não é possível acessar o tomcat de qualquer lugar, a não ser localhost, sem firewall, o curl responde no localhost: 8080

0

Eu tenho uma nova instalação mínima do CentOS 7 que está executando o Tomcat nele. Im incapaz de puxar o site de qualquer lugar através do navegador, mas pode vê-lo tentando servir no 8080 do netstat. O serviço está sendo executado corretamente quando eu verifico o status do serviço tomcat (também, o httpd e o JAVA estão funcionando corretamente). Eu posso enrolar o localhost: 8080 e obter o código do site do Tomcat como uma resposta, mas ele não vai arrancar de outro sistema, indo para link . Se eu executar o netstat, posso vê-lo escutando 8080, mas se eu executar o nmap no IP privado, ele não mostrará 80 (ou 8080) aberto nele. Eu não tenho firewall / IPTables instalados neste sistema ainda assim não deveria estar bloqueando isto. Im capaz de pingar o sistema muito bem de outros sistemas.

Não consigo encontrar a resposta para isso. Eu segui muitos guias sobre a instalação, mas não consigo encontrar a solução. Por favor, deixe-me saber se há algo que está faltando ou se você tem alguma pista. Obrigado pelo seu tempo!

    
por saleetzo 08.05.2017 / 23:28

1 resposta

0

O problema foi comigo reutilizar um endereço IP antigo que já tinha uma regra de firewall de rede anexada a ele. Eu tinha certeza de que tudo estava correto no sistema, então quando cheirei os pacotes indo para o servidor, vi que eles foram descartados no nível do firewall da rede. Resolvido isso e tudo estava bem.

    
por 09.05.2017 / 20:50